Las Vegas, USA
Often referred to as the gambling capital of the world, Las Vegas stands as an iconic destination for casino enthusiasts. With extravagant resorts such as Bellagio, Wynn, and Caesars Palace, the city not only offers a variety of gaming activities but also showcases a vibrant entertainment scene, delicious dining options, and luxurious accommodations. The 24-hour nature of Las Vegas ensures that thrill-seekers can enjoy gaming around the clock, with slot machines and poker tables waiting to welcome players at any hour.
Macau, China
Macau has gained a reputation as the “Gambling Capital of the World,” surpassing Las Vegas in gaming revenue. The region is known for its massive casinos, such as The Venetian Macao and Galaxy Macau, which rival some of the most opulent establishments globally. The fusion of traditional Chinese gambling games like Pai Gow and Western-style gaming creates a unique atmosphere, drawing vast crowds from China and abroad. The ongoing development of integrated resorts signifies Macau’s commitment to enhancing its position as a premier gaming destination.
Monaco
Known for its exclusivity and glamour, the Monte Carlo Casino is one of the most famous gambling venues in the world. It has been depicted in numerous films and is synonymous with luxury and high-stakes play. While it attracts wealthy clientele, the casino’s intricate architecture and rich history provide a captivating backdrop for all visitors. The allure of Monaco extends beyond gambling, with its stunning coastlines, high-end shopping, and world-class events like the Monaco Grand Prix attracting millions of tourists each year.
Singapore
In recent years, Singapore has emerged as a significant player in the global casino landscape. The city-state houses two of the most notable integrated resorts: Marina Bay Sands and Resorts World Sentosa. Both establishments have transformed the gambling experience by combining entertainment, shopping, fine dining, and luxurious accommodations. The significant government support and regulatory framework have facilitated a thriving casino market, making Singapore a go-to destination for both regional and international travelers.
Regulations Surrounding Non-UK Casinos
A critical aspect of non-UK casinos is the regulatory environment in which they operate. Each country has its licensing requirements and gaming regulations, significantly influencing how casinos operate and market themselves. For instance, in the USA, regulations can differ from state to state, creating a patchwork of gaming laws that operators must navigate. Conversely, in places like Singapore and Macau, authorities enact strict regulations to promote responsible gaming while generating substantial revenue for the local economy.
The licensing conditions for casinos generally include extensive background checks, ensuring operators maintain integrity and adhere to fair gaming practices. This regulatory framework helps to protect players while also promoting responsible gaming initiatives intended to minimize gambling addiction and enhance player safety—an essential consideration in any thriving gaming market.
